The routing algorithm was developed using RSLogix 5000 and run in SoftLogix5800 of version 13. Both these software tools are products of Rockwell Automation. To have a better understanding of the problem definition, algorithm, and results, some very general information about RSLogix5000 and SoftLogix5800 is included in this session
SoftLogix Controller
SoftLogix5800 is a soft controller and comes from the category of programmable automation controllers. The control functions written for the application are downloaded into a programmable controller. The SoftLogix controller encapsulates them in software and runs on operating system. We can develop our own custom programs in other programming languages to integrate via external routines. The specific product used currently is 1789-L60/A SoftLogix5860 controller. The memory size for this soft controller is 3072KB. One can always choose the memory size that the application requires. It also consists of a built-in I/O simulation model for easier design and validation. The application can also be divided into tasks for structured program development. It is flexible/ scalable to build our own control system with functionality that will suit specific needs. A SoftLogix Chassis Monitor is shown below. The 16 slots can be filled in with various controllers downloaded with their respective programs.
The chassis monitor is the interface to the SoftLogix controller. We use the monitor to: • Add and configure controllers • Add and configure communication cards • Add and configure motion cards • Change processor mode • Monitor controller and associated module status • Monitor motion performanceBased on the requirements, we can define the chassis monitor with number of slots according to the user preference as shown in the figure below.
A SoftLogix controller is the software that is installed inside the computer. A computer to have SoftLogix should meet the following requirements. • IBM-compatible Pentium 41.6 GHz • 256 Kbytes of RAM • 50 Mbytes hard disk spaceRSLogix 5000
RSLogix 5000 Enterprise Series software is an IEC 61131-3 compliant software package that offers relay ladder, structured text, function block diagram, and sequential function chart editors for you to develop application programs [3].
• Instructions can be created by encapsulating a section of logic in any programming language into an add-on instruction. • RSLogix 5000 Enterprise Series software also includes axis configuration and programming support for motion control. • With RSLogix 5000 Enterprise Series software, only one software package for sequential, process, drive, motion control, and safety programming is required. • The RSLogix 5000 Enterprise Series environment offers an easy-to-use, IEC61131-3 compliant interface, symbolic programming with structures and arrays, and a comprehensive instruction set that serves many types of applications.
• It supports relay ladder, structured text, function block diagram, and sequential function chart editors for you to develop application programs.PC Hardware Requirements: The client computer must have at least: • a 600MHz or greater Intel Pentium® II, or Pentium-compatible microprocessor (1GHz or greater recommended) • 256 MB of RAM (512 MB or more recommended) • a CD-ROM drive • 250 MB of free hard disk space (or more depending on application requirements) • a 3.5-inch, 1.4MB disk drive (if using RSLogix 5000 professional for activation) For various industrial applications, RSLogix5000 can be used to write logic to provide automated control.
Also read 3 Commonly used Programming languages for PLC Advantages of PLC